Deck Sanding Service in Seattle, WA
Deck sanding services involve carefully removing the top layer of a wooden deck's surface to eliminate roughness, splinters, and old, peeling stain or paint. This process prepares the wood for a fresh application of stain, sealant, or paint, helping to restore the deck’s appearance and extend its lifespan. Homeowners often request deck sanding for projects such as refreshing an outdoor space before hosting gatherings, repairing weathered or damaged wood, or maintaining the overall safety and aesthetic of their decks. It’s important for property owners to understand that proper sanding can improve the look and durability of the deck, but it also requires selecting the right equipment and techniques for the specific wood type and condition.
Before requesting deck sanding services, property owners should consider the current state of their deck, including the presence of loose paint, peeling stain, or surface splinters. Clarifying the desired outcome-whether a smooth, natural wood finish or a prepared surface for staining-is also helpful. Additionally, understanding the size and complexity of the project can influence the scope of work, and homeowners should inquire about the types of sandpaper or abrasives used to ensure compatibility with their deck’s material. Proper preparation and communication can help ensure the results meet expectations and contribute to a safe, attractive outdoor space.

Deck Sanding Service Questions
What is deck sanding? Deck sanding involves smoothing the surface of a wooden deck to remove roughness, splinters, and old finishes, preparing it for staining or sealing.
When should a deck be sanded? A deck should be sanded when the surface appears rough, faded, or has splinters, especially before applying a new stain or finish.
What types of projects benefit from deck sanding? Projects such as restoring weathered decks, removing peeling paint or stain, and preparing new or repaired wood for finishing benefit from deck sanding.
What should property owners know before sanding a deck? Proper sanding ensures a smooth surface and better finish adhesion; it may require cleaning afterward to remove dust and debris.
